Abstract: PURPOSE: A spacer strap is provided to fix intersected wire ring and parts elements while to prevent unlocking by vibration, by adapting strap capable of being rotated with its head portion at a spacing position. CONSTITUTION: A spacer strap comprises a strap(22) as a binding unit, and a spacing portion(14) connecting a head portion(24) together. The head portion is able to be rotated at the spacing portion. The spacer strap uses common strap which binds a wire ring and parts elements together. The strap has a fixing protrusion(26a) at a band portion(26) for maintaining fastening state. An engaging sill(25b) is formed at a contact face with the fixing protrusion in a recess(25a) of the head portion. The spacing portion connects the head portion with the spacer strap. The fixing protrusion is engaged with the engaging sill of the head portion, thereby preventing unlocking by vibration.

Abstract: Fuel pulsation reduction device and the method using the piezoelectric element are provided to manage individually the amplitude or the various frequency of the pulsating coming in and to simplify the organization of space within the fuel delivery pipe. A fuel pulsation reduction device comprises a fuel delivery pipe(100) in which the fuel is flowed into one side, a first piezoelectric element part(110) generating the fine voltage, a second piezoelectric element(112) generating the offsetting pulsating offsetting the fuel pulsating according to the fine voltage generated in the first piezoelectric element part.

Abstract: An apparatus for preventing an engine from being wet is provided to eliminate the necessity of forming a vaporizer unit on a fuel line and reduce fuel consumption by preventing an intake port from being wet through an ultrasonic vibration unit. An intake port(11) is connected to one side of a cylinder(50), and an injector(10) is mounted on an outlet port of the intake port so as to supply fuel in accordance with the control of an electronic control unit. The outlet port of the intake port has a bottom surface on which an ultrasonic vibration unit(30) is formed opposite to the fuel injection direction of the injector. The ultrasonic vibration unit prevents the intake port from being wet by the injected fuel.

Abstract: PURPOSE: A disconnection preventive apparatus of a wire harness for a door in a vehicle is provided to restrict disconnection from fatigue by minimizing stress of the wire harness in opening and closing the door. CONSTITUTION: A wire harness disconnection preventive device of a door for a vehicle is composed of a motor(15) pulling a wire harness(2) through a wire(16); a door opening detecting switch supplying and shutting off power to the motor in opening and closing the door; and a spring(14) returning the wire harness in not operating the motor. The remaining part is drawn out of a housing(11) by pulling the wire harness with the wire in opening the door, and tension is not applied to the wire harness. The wire harness is moved into the housing by restoring force of the spring in closing the door. Stress is minimized by preventing deformation without compressive force in opening and closing the door.
